HP 15 TouchSmart Notebook PC
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

I got a pop up while I was away from my desk, tiny block with the box title "HP Update", the text says "Access is Denied" the task manager properties says UP UPdate Client, but there is no information on the update client on HP.com, or this error.

Any recomendations?

I understand that you are getting a pop up HP Update "Access is denied" and this issue just started.

 

I'll try my best to help.

 

I suggest you uninstall and reinstall the HP Support Assistance from your computer.

 

To uninstall HP Support Assistant, 

  1. In Windows, search for and open change or remove a program.

  2. On the Programs and Features window, select HP Support Assistant, then click the Uninstall button.

  3. Figure : Uninstall HP Support Assistant

    Uninstall screen from the Control Panel with HP Support Assistant highlighted

       NOTE: If HP Support Assistant is not listed or does not uninstall correctly, install the latest HP Support Assistant version without uninstalling the old version. After HP Support Assistant is installed and working, repeat the uninstall steps.

  4. Click Yes on the Programs and Features screen to confirm you want to uninstall HP Support Assistant.

    Figure : Uninstall confirmation

    Confirmation screen for an uninstall with Yes selected
  5. Restart the computer to complete the process.

Then download the HP Support Assistant from this Link: https://hp.care/2Ew95x3

  1. Open the HPSA and Click My devices to see My PC. In this box, there are two options, Updates and Messages, both of which could require attention. You know attention is required if you see an exclamation mark.

    Figure : My PC

    My PC with Updates and Messages highlighted
  2. Click Updates if it has an exclamation mark next to it. If there is no exclamation mark next to Updates, skip to step 6.

  3. From the Updates available section, check the boxes for all the updates, then click Download and install.
